DatonKallandor posted:It's a game based entirely on writing. Is it really sad that people will give more money to a writer they know can write? It's not like this is some kind of never before seen super smart mechanics driven thing. It's just a book where you move cards into slots to unlock more pages. No, it's more sad that an unknown writer with a cool pitch like this would not have anywhere near the marketing reach to do as well. Alexis is getting so much dosh precisely because he's so high-profile, and Failbetter Games also sent out an email letting people know about him. Compare/contrast Alcyone, a work of interactive fiction that looks cool and has a demo and it still basically barely scraped by only thanks to RPS giving them an article. (Not to say that Alcyone is on the same level of writing quality or graphical quality, but you know that it's not about the skill here but the marketing reach instead.)
